Understanding Windshield Wiper Sizes for the 2016 Nissan Murano
The 2016 Nissan Murano typically uses two different wiper blade sizes – one for the driver's side and another for the passenger's side. Knowing these specific measurements is the first step in replacing your wipers effectively.
The standard windshield wiper sizes for a 2016 Nissan Murano are:
- Driver Side: 26 inches
- Passenger Side: 18 inches
It's important to note that these are the most common sizes, but variations might exist based on specific trim levels or regional differences. Therefore, it's always best to double-check before making a purchase. There are several methods to confirm the correct size for your specific vehicle.
Methods to Confirm Your Wiper Blade Size
While the above sizes are the standard, here are reliable methods to verify you're getting the right fit for your 2016 Nissan Murano:
- Check Your Owner's Manual: Your owner's manual is the definitive source of information for your vehicle. It will typically list the exact windshield wiper sizes recommended by Nissan. Refer to the index or the section on maintenance and replacement parts.
- Measure Your Existing Wiper Blades: Carefully remove your existing wiper blades and measure their lengths. Use a measuring tape or ruler to get an accurate measurement in inches. This is the most foolproof method, as it accounts for any potential previous replacements with incorrect sizes.
- Use an Online Wiper Size Finder: Many auto parts retailers, both online and in brick-and-mortar stores, offer wiper size finders. Simply enter your vehicle's year, make, and model (2016 Nissan Murano), and the tool will provide the correct wiper sizes. Reputable sites like Rain-X, Bosch, and AutoZone are good starting points.
- Consult a Local Auto Parts Store: Visit your local auto parts store and ask a knowledgeable employee for assistance. They can look up the correct wiper sizes for your vehicle and even help you install the new blades.
Types of Windshield Wipers for Your 2016 Nissan Murano
Once you've confirmed the correct sizes, you'll need to choose the type of wiper blade that best suits your needs and budget. Here's a brief overview of the most common types:
- Conventional Wiper Blades: These are the most traditional and affordable type of wiper blade. They feature a metal frame with several pressure points that distribute pressure across the rubber blade. While they are cost-effective, they tend to wear out more quickly and may not perform as well in extreme weather conditions.
- Beam Blades: Beam blades have a more aerodynamic design and a single, continuous rubber blade. This design allows for more even pressure distribution across the windshield, resulting in a cleaner and more consistent wipe. They also tend to last longer and perform better in snow and ice. Beam blades are often a bit more expensive than conventional blades.
- Hybrid Wiper Blades: Hybrid blades combine the features of both conventional and beam blades. They have a covered frame that protects the blade from the elements, while still providing the even pressure distribution of a beam blade. Hybrid blades are a good compromise between performance and price.
- Winter Wiper Blades: Winter wiper blades are specifically designed for use in snowy and icy conditions. They feature a heavier rubber compound and a protective boot that prevents ice and snow from building up on the blade. These blades are ideal if you live in an area with harsh winters.
Choosing the Right Wiper Blade Material
The material of the wiper blade itself also plays a crucial role in its performance and longevity. The two most common materials are rubber and silicone.
- Rubber Wiper Blades: Rubber blades are the most common and affordable option. They provide adequate wiping performance for most conditions, but they can degrade more quickly in extreme temperatures and exposure to sunlight.
- Silicone Wiper Blades: Silicone wiper blades are more durable and resistant to extreme temperatures and UV damage than rubber blades. They also tend to provide a smoother and quieter wiping action. While they are more expensive, they can last significantly longer than rubber blades, making them a worthwhile investment in the long run.
Installation Tips for Your 2016 Nissan Murano Wiper Blades
Installing new wiper blades on your 2016 Nissan Murano is a relatively straightforward process that you can typically do yourself. Here are some helpful tips:
- Protect Your Windshield: Before removing the old blades, place a towel or cloth over your windshield to protect it from accidental damage if the wiper arm snaps back.
- Understand the Attachment Mechanism: Familiarize yourself with the type of attachment mechanism used on your wiper arms. Common types include J-hook, pin-lock, and side-lock. The new blades should come with instructions on how to attach them properly.
- Remove the Old Blades: Carefully detach the old wiper blades from the wiper arms. Depending on the attachment type, you may need to press a release button or slide the blade off the arm.
- Attach the New Blades: Attach the new wiper blades to the wiper arms, ensuring they are securely locked in place. Follow the instructions that came with the new blades.
- Test the New Blades: After installing the new blades, test them by spraying windshield washer fluid and running the wipers through a full cycle. Check for any streaking or skipping.
Maintaining Your Windshield Wipers
Proper maintenance can significantly extend the life of your windshield wipers and ensure optimal performance. Here are some essential maintenance tips:
- Clean Your Windshield Regularly: Dirt, grime, and debris can accumulate on your windshield and damage your wiper blades. Clean your windshield regularly with a glass cleaner to remove these contaminants.
- Clean Your Wiper Blades: Periodically clean your wiper blades with a damp cloth to remove any accumulated dirt or debris.
- Replace Wiper Blades Regularly: Even with proper maintenance, wiper blades will eventually wear out. Replace your wiper blades every six to twelve months, or sooner if you notice streaking, skipping, or other signs of wear.
- Use Windshield Washer Fluid: Always use a high-quality windshield washer fluid to keep your windshield clean and lubricated. Avoid using plain water, as it can freeze in cold weather and damage your wiper system.
- Lift Wiper Blades in Cold Weather: In cold weather, lift your wiper blades away from the windshield to prevent them from freezing to the glass.
Troubleshooting Common Wiper Blade Problems
Even with the correct size and proper maintenance, you may occasionally encounter problems with your windshield wipers. Here are some common issues and their potential solutions:
- Streaking: Streaking is often caused by dirty or worn wiper blades. Clean the blades or replace them if necessary.
- Skipping: Skipping can be caused by a dry windshield or worn wiper blades. Use windshield washer fluid and replace the blades if the problem persists.
- Squeaking: Squeaking can be caused by dry wiper blades or a dirty windshield. Clean the windshield and lubricate the blades with windshield washer fluid.
- Chattering: Chattering is often caused by an incorrect wiper arm angle. Consult a mechanic to adjust the wiper arm angle.
